Strengthening Women's Contribution to the Formal and Informal Economies in the Middle East and North Africa

The Department of State's Bureau of Near Eastern Affairs Office of Assistance Coordination (NEA/AC) announces a Notice of Funding Opportunity (NOFO) for projects designed to support women's economic empowerment initiatives in the Middle East and North Africa (MENA) region.
